Urolithin A is a natural compound produced by gut microbiota through the metabolism of ellagitannins found in foods such as pomegranates, strawberries, and walnuts. In recent years, it has garnered significant attention in the fields of anti-aging and muscle health due to its unique ability to activate mitochondrial autophagy. As the first natural compound scientifically recognized for its capacity to promote mitochondrial autophagy, Urolithin A offers a novel approach to mitigating age-related functional decline by clearing dysfunctional mitochondria from cells.
Core Mechanism of Action: Activating Mitochondrial Autophagy
Mitochondria serve as the cell's "energy factories," and their function naturally declines with age. Urolithin A's core function lies in activating mitochondrial autophagy—a cellular self-cleaning process that selectively eliminates damaged mitochondria while promoting the generation of healthy ones.
Key pathways involved include:
PINK1/Parkin-dependent pathway: Stabilizes the PINK1 protein and recruits the Parkin protein to damaged mitochondria, thereby initiating autophagy.
PINK1/Parkin-independent pathway: Induces mitochondrial autophagy via alternative receptor proteins (e.g., BNIP3, FUNDC1).
Restoration of lysosomal function: Research conducted at Tongji University has revealed that Urolithin A can also restore lysosomal function—specifically in models of Alzheimer's disease—by regulating Cathepsin Z (CTSZ), thereby facilitating the more efficient clearance of damaged organelles.
This mechanism not only aids in maintaining cellular energy metabolism but is also closely linked to delaying the onset and progression of various age-related diseases.
Scientific Evidence for Anti-Aging and Muscle Health Benefits
1. Improving Muscle Function and Endurance
Multiple clinical studies have substantiated the benefits of Urolithin A for muscle health:
Study in Older Adults (*JAMA Network Open*, 2022)
Study Design: 66 older adults (aged 65–90) received daily supplementation of either 1,000 mg of Urolithin A or a placebo for a period of four months.
Key Findings:
Improved Muscle Endurance: Indicators of muscle endurance in both the hands and legs demonstrated improvement.
Optimization of Biomarkers: Plasma levels of acylcarnitines and ceramides—biomarkers reflecting mitochondrial health—as well as levels of the inflammatory marker C-reactive protein (CRP), were significantly reduced. Safety Profile: The supplement is safe and well-tolerated.
Limitations: Improvements in the 6-minute walk distance and maximum ATP production in hand muscles did not reach statistical significance.
Study in Middle-Aged Adults (*Cell Reports Medicine*, 2022)
Study Design: 88 overweight middle-aged adults (aged 40–64) were tested using doses of 500 mg and 1000 mg of Urolithin A.
Key Findings: The Urolithin A groups demonstrated positive signals regarding certain measures of muscle strength, mitochondrial-related biomarkers, and peak oxygen uptake (VO₂peak).
2. Anti-Aging and Healthspan Extension
Extending Lifespan in Model Organisms: As early as 2016, a study published in *Nature Medicine* demonstrated that Urolithin A could extend the lifespan of *C. elegans* (roundworms) by 45%.
Improving Stem Cell Function: Studies indicate that Urolithin A can reverse the aging characteristics of senescent hematopoietic stem cells, restoring their hematopoietic capacity; this process is directly linked to the activation of mitochondrial autophagy (mitophagy).
Combating Metabolic Aging: In the context of diabetes, Urolithin A can reduce senescence in bone marrow mesenchymal stem cells by activating the PINK1/PARKIN mitophagy pathway and modulating the NRF2/SIRT1/P53 senescence signaling pathways.
3. Neuroprotection and Cognitive Enhancement
Alzheimer's Disease Models: Research from Tongji University indicates that long-term Urolithin A treatment can improve learning, memory, and olfactory function in AD model mice, while also reducing cerebral amyloid-beta (Aβ) and tau protein pathology. The underlying mechanism is closely linked to the restoration of mitochondrial autophagy and lysosomal function.
Crossing the Blood-Brain Barrier: Urolithin A is capable of crossing the blood-brain barrier, thereby exerting direct effects on the central nervous system.
4. Immunomodulation and Anti-Cancer Potential
Enhancing Anti-Tumor Immunity: Research from Germany revealed that Urolithin A-induced mitochondrial autophagy promotes the expansion of T memory stem cells (T_SCM)—cells possessing potent anti-tumor capabilities—offering a novel avenue for cancer immunotherapy.
Safety, Dosage, and Product Applications
Safety Profile
GRAS Certification: In 2018, the U.S. FDA designated Urolithin A as a "Generally Recognized as Safe" (GRAS) ingredient, permitting its use in food products and dietary supplements. Clinical Tolerability: Short-term clinical trials (up to 4 months in duration) indicate that Urolithin A is generally well-tolerated. The most common adverse reactions are mild gastrointestinal discomfort (e.g., bloating, stomach upset), occurring at a low incidence rate.
Precautions:
Lack of Long-Term Data: Currently, the longest human trial conducted spans only 4 months; long-term safety data for periods exceeding one year remains unavailable.
Special Populations: Pregnant and breastfeeding women, as well as individUrolithin Als with autoimmune diseases, should exercise caution when using this product.
Drug Interactions: Urolithin A is metabolized by hepatic UGT enzymes; theoretically, it may interact with drugs metabolized via the same pathway, although systematic studies investigating such interactions are currently lacking.
Recommended Dosage
Based on existing clinical studies, the reference dosage for daily supplementation is as follows:
Standard Dosage: 500–1000 mg/day.
Dosage Selection:
500 mg/day: The low-dose group in the ENERGIZE trial, which demonstrated improvements in muscle strength; this may represent a cost-effective starting dose.
1000 mg/day: The high dose adopted in the majority of clinical trials, and also the recommended dosage for most commercial products.
FDA-Recognized Range: Content per serving in food or dietary supplements should fall between 250 mg and 1000 mg.
Products and Market Applications
Key Brands: Mitopure®, developed by the Swiss company Amazentis, is currently the only synthetic Urolithin A ingredient to have received both FDA GRAS status and NSF certification; its consumer brand is Timeline.
Application Forms:
Dietary Supplements: Available in forms such as softgels, powders, etc., used to support muscle health and anti-aging.
Skincare Products: In October 2023, Urolithin A successfully completed product filing in China (Filing No.: Guo ZhUrolithin Ang YUrolithin An Bei Zi 20230036) for use as an anti-wrinkle agent in skincare cosmetics. Timeline has also launched a comprehensive Urolithin A-based skincare line.
Food Additives: Can be incorporated into various food products, such as protein shakes, meal-replacement beverages, nutrition bars, yogurt, etc.
Controversies, Limitations, and Future Outlook
Research Limitations and Controversies
Singular Funding Source: To date, nearly all published human Randomized Controlled Trials (RCTs) have been funded or led by Amazentis; the lack of independent third-party verification may introduce selective reporting bias. Inconsistent Clinical Outcomes: Some key functional metrics (such as the 6-minute walk distance) did not demonstrate statistically significant improvement in clinical trials.
Significant IndividUrolithin Al Variability: Only approximately 40% of the population possesses the specific gut microbiota capable of efficiently converting dietary precursors into Urolithin A; this may result in the efficacy of supplementation varying significantly from person to person.
Future Directions for Research
Long-Term Efficacy and Safety: Large-scale, long-term clinical trials spanning more than one year are required.
Elucidation of Mechanisms of Action: Identifying the specific molecular mediators of Urolithin A within various tissues and under different disease states.
Personalized Applications: Exploring precision supplementation strategies tailored to individUrolithin Al gut microbiota profiles.
Combination Therapies: Investigating the synergistic effects of Urolithin A when combined with other anti-aging or health-promoting interventions.
Conclusion
As a natural compound that combats cellular aging by activating mitochondrial autophagy, Urolithin A (Urolithin A) has demonstrated preliminary, promising clinical evidence regarding the improvement of muscle endurance and the optimization of biomarkers for mitochondrial health. Its mechanism of action is scientifically sound, and it has exhibited a favorable safety profile in short-term clinical trials.
However, consumers and healthcare practitioners should maintain a balanced and realistic perspective:
Not a "Magic Pill": Urolithin A serves as a potential adjunct for healthy aging, not a shortcut to replace a healthy lifestyle (specifically, a balanced diet and regular exercise).
IndividUrolithin Al Variability: Given that efficacy is influenced by the gut microbiota's conversion capacity, direct supplementation with standardized Urolithin A products may be a more reliable approach than relying solely on dietary precursors.
Ongoing Research: The majority of positive data currently available stems from short-term, industry-funded studies; consequently, the long-term benefits and generalizability of these findings still require further independent validation.
